Contestants will be judged in a private interview, in evening gown, in swim suit and in a talent show. The winner will go on the Miss Utah Pageant. Applications may be obtained through the recreation department or through Beverly Olson at City Hall. Special to The Tribune SANDY Applications for the May 3 annual Miss Sandy Pageant are being solicited by the Sandy City Recreation Department. The U.S. Forest Service, which manages much of the land in the d im Proposed Jail Siles Draw No Complaints in Davis - Editorial Elected olficiuls in Salt Lake County are finally confronting what promises, to be a contentious, but extremely important issue developing a master plan for the canyons of the Wasatch Front After years of haphazard development and inconsistent policy, a group of county policymakers has decided to sit down and try to negotiate a long-terplan for the canyons. The group, known as the Wasatch Canyon Interagency Coordinating Committee, holds its first meeting Wednesday The committee will consist of a policy group, composed of elected officials, supported by a tei hnieal group, composed of people expert in such fields as water development, pollution control, avalanche safety and highway maintenance. This enthusiasm for canyon planning was prompted by many factors, most important of which was probably the state's unsuccessful bid for the Winter Olympics Debate over the Olympic bid highlighted the almost total absence of long-terplanning for the canyons. ii yWTiilif I |
